Study of blind equalization algorithm based on third-second order normalized cumulant in PAM system

Abstract
A novel third-second order normalized cumulant blind equalization algorithm based on symmetric-to-asymmetric transformation(SAT) is brought forward.The defect is overcome in this paper,which channel equalization can not be directly applied because the third order cumulant of symmetrically distributed signal is zero.Simulation results show that the proposed algorithm has better performances with low complexity,fast convergence and small steady residual error than the same algorithm.
